How they compare
North Macedonia currently reports 47.88 against 47.59 in Peru, a difference of 0.29.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 15 shared years of data; in 1999 it was North Macedonia ahead.
North Macedonia ranks 31st and Peru ranks 35th of 103 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, North Macedonia averaged higher in 2 and Peru in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| North Macedonia | Peru |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 45.75 | 40.37 | 5.38 | North Macedonia |
| 2000s | 41.46 | 41.69 | 0.2324 | Peru |
| 2010s | 44.6 | 45.89 | 1.29 | Peru |
| 2020s | 47.88 | 47.26 | 0.6154 | North Macedonia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
